OS X lion y SSD

7

Hace poco recibí un Crucial M4 SSD para mi MacBook Pro 13 "(2.53 GHz) a mediados de 2009. Como pagué algo de dinero, me gustaría obtener el mejor rendimiento posible. Realizar una prueba de velocidad en App Store Black Magic Speed Test, mostró 260 Mb de lectura y 170 Mb de escritura, aunque en el sitio web de Crucial dice que la lectura de hasta 500 Mb. Trim no está habilitada y el firmware es el más reciente (0309).

La velocidad de conexión es SATA 3 GB / s.

¿Es normal este rendimiento o algo va mal?

Desde el generador de perfiles del sistema:

Vendor: NVidia
 Product:   MCP79 AHCI
 Link Speed:    3 Gigabit
 Negotiated Link Speed: 3 Gigabit
 Description:   AHCI Version 1.20 Supported

   M4-CT128M4SSD2:

      Capacity: 128.04 GB (128,035,676,160 bytes)
      Model:    M4-CT128M4SSD2                          
      Revision: 309
      Serial Number:    000000001204032BCB4A
      Native Command Queuing:   Yes
      Queue Depth:  32
      Removable Media:  No
      Detachable Drive: No
      BSD Name: disk0
      Medium Type:  Solid State
      TRIM Support: No
      Partition Map Type:   GPT (GUID Partition Table)
      S.M.A.R.T. status:    Verified
      Volumes:
    disk0s1:
      Capacity: 209.7 MB (209,715,200 bytes)
      BSD Name: disk0s1
      Content:  EFI
    Macintosh HD:
      Capacity: 127.18 GB (127,175,917,568 bytes)
      Available:    63.01 GB (63,009,751,040 bytes)
      Writable: Yes
      File System:  Journaled HFS+
      BSD Name: disk0s2
      Mount Point:  /
      Content:  Apple_HFS
    Recovery HD:
      Capacity: 650 MB (650,002,432 bytes)
      BSD Name: disk0s3
      Content:  Apple_Boot
    
pregunta latusaki 13.03.2012 - 01:21

3 respuestas

10

La velocidad de enlace de su SSD está limitada por la transmisión de datos de la interfaz SATA y la sobrecarga de protocolo .

  • SATA 3 (6 Gbit / s): máx. 600MB / s
  • SATA 2 (3 Gbit / s): máx. 300MB / s
  • SATA 1 (1.5 Gbit / s): máx. 150MB / s

Un documento de la Organización Internacional Serial ATA dice:

  

¿Cuál es la tasa de transferencia de datos en el mundo real de SATA 6Gb / s?

     

Respuesta:
La velocidad de transferencia realizable a través de un enlace SATA de 6 Gb / s depende de la eficiencia del diseño del controlador tanto en el lado host como en el lado del dispositivo de la interconexión. La interfaz SATA 6Gb / s transmite información a 600 MB / s, sin embargo, no todos los 600 MB / s se realizan como la carga útil de datos del usuario porque el protocolo incluye otros datos y comunicaciones de intercambio entre el host y el dispositivo. En general, la interfaz SATA es muy eficiente. Las tasas de transferencia realizadas suelen estar muy cerca del máximo teórico , que es uno de los principales beneficios de la tecnología SATA para dispositivos de almacenamiento masivo.

     

¿Qué sobrecarga hace que la tasa de transferencia de 6Gb / s se reduzca al rendimiento real?

     

Respuesta:
Hay dos categorías generales de sobrecarga que entran en juego: una comunicación utilizada para enviar comandos y recibir el estado, y una comunicación de bajo nivel que maneja los apretones de manos entre el host y los dispositivos para asegurar la integridad de la transmisión.

Es mejor comparar sus tasas de rendimiento con las de otros usuarios de Crucial M4. Una comparación óptima compararía discos usando el mismo firmware, herramienta de referencia y la interfaz SATA.

Sin embargo, la mejor comparación que encontré es una hilo en forum.crucial.com . En este hilo, los usuarios están comparando las velocidades de Crucial M4 128GB (firmware 009) en una interfaz SATA 2. Aunque esté utilizando un firmware diferente, los resultados deberían ser algo comparables porque la actualización de firmware 0309 no estaba dirigida a mejorar las tasas de transferencia. A juzgar por este hilo, diría que tu rendimiento está bien.

La única forma de obtener la velocidad prometida del Crucial M4 es mediante una interfaz SATA 3. En mi MBP actualmente estoy usando un Crucial M4 de 128 GB (firmware 0309) con una interfaz SATA 3. El Black Magic Speed Test me da:

  • máx. 510 MB / s de lectura
  • máx. 190 MB / s escribe
respondido por el gentmatt 13.03.2012 - 09:29
3

Usted recibe un gran éxito ejecutándose en una conexión SATA2 en lugar de SATA3. Echando un vistazo rápido a la revisión de Anandtech del M4, sus números no se ven fuera de lugar.

enlace

La única forma más fácil de hacer que las cosas sean más rápidas es actualizar a un disco más grande.

Debe ser consciente del rendimiento a lo largo del tiempo. Debido a que TRIM no se está ejecutando, depende de la recolección de basura de la unidad para mantener el rendimiento. Hay formas de implementar TRIM en Lion para unidades SSD que no son de Apple, pero las revisiones son variadas. No tengo idea de cuán efectivo es el GC en la M4 cuando se usa con OS X.

    
respondido por el Bill Tanner 13.03.2012 - 02:49
0

Las respuestas existentes son buenas, pero en realidad no mencionan una última cosa que incluiré aquí solo para que se mencione en forma completa. Cualquier clasificación de velocidad dada para los SSD es una indicación de las velocidades relativas de transferencia de datos del controlador integrado en la unidad, no de la unidad real. Ahora, a diferencia de una unidad de disco giratorio normal en la que el controlador está en gran parte en la placa base y las unidades (almacenando en caché a un lado) simplemente almacenando y recuperando sus datos, el controlador en una unidad SSD tiene más capacidades, y esa es la capacidad de comprimir / descomprimir Sus datos sobre la marcha en el camino de entrada / salida.

Por lo tanto, si envía un archivo de datos cuidadosamente formateado que se puede (de) comprimir fácilmente, el controlador lo hará, y esto puede significar que ignorar la cantidad de lectura / escritura que realmente se ha hecho, las cifras pueden parecer inflado. Para obtener 500Mb / s necesitas estas condiciones. Es un poco confuso, pero para presentar tal velocidad no se habrá escrito a esa velocidad, simplemente se comprimirá y escribirá (digamos que se obtiene un 50% de reducción / aumento de tamaño, entonces eso es un efectivo duplicación de la transferencia de datos).

Obviamente esto es un poco de engaño, pero todos lo hacen. Una estadística más interesante son las cifras de IOP, pero esa es otra historia.

Black Magic es una prueba más verdadera, ya que utiliza datos que no se pueden comprimir sobre la marcha para aumentar las velocidades de transferencia, ya que ya está muy comprimido. Brinda una representación más real de sus capacidades, y obtener 250Mb + en una línea SATA2 es bastante bueno.

    
respondido por el stuffe 15.06.2012 - 16:03

Lea otras preguntas en las etiquetas